How to Estimate Backyard Remodelling Costs
Estimating backyard restoration costs ought to constantly start with a prepare for the project. If you do not understand specifically what you wish to alter, upgrade, or add, it can be very hard to produce a practical allocate the work. Likewise, if you have a fixed quantity you want to spend on the remodelling, you might need to restrict the upgrades to continue to be listed below your cap.
Backyard patio

Chris Turner, the owner and designer at Elevate deliberately, gives four simple tips to aid you approximate your yard restoration expenses:

Break down what you’ll require for products, labor, allows, equipment, and so on.
If you’re going to work with for the job, ensure to get a number of quotes.
Use online expense calculators and speak to other people that have actually done other comparable projects.
Ensure to factor in concealed costs, like dirt preparation and disposal costs.
” Spring and summer are the busiest seasons for this sort of job, so rates is always mosting likely to be higher,” Turner states. “Autumn and winter will generally be cheaper for jobs. Plus specialists could use lower pricing throughout sluggish months.” With this in mind, you could be able to stretch your budget a little bit additional by preparing backyard improvements or purchasing products throughout the off-season while you wait for the weather condition to enhance.
6 Backyard Improvement Concepts to Stretch Your Budget
Not all renovation tasks come with the exact same price tag, so while you construct a budget plan, it deserves taking into consideration exactly how you can extend your funds by making basic modifications to the strategy– whether jeopardizing on range or taking on a part of the job as a DIY task to minimize labor expenses.

1. Landscape design Upgrades
Landscape design upgrades can be a fast, reliable choice for significantly transforming your yard’s look. Something as simple as growing a tree or including a yard can mainly affect an otherwise plain backyard. “Including fresh compost will instantaneously include visual appeal, and it’ll only set you back around $100 to $300,” explains Turner. He additionally recommends using indigenous or drought-resistant plants. “You will not have to stress over long-term upkeep and these plants can be added for a couple hundred dollars.”

2. Garden Course Design
Creating a pathway via the lawn not only provides the yard a distinct look yet likewise includes in the functionality of the space, making it less complicated for you to navigate through the yard without harming the turf or stepping on flowers and various other plants. The typical DIYer can normally manage a garden path installation job, though alloted adequate time to collect the yard, degree the ground, and lay the rocks or pavers. Purchase yard course pavers throughout the off-season to save on the general price.

3. Firepit Installation
Among the extra typical enhancements to a yard is a firepit or outside fire place. This attribute stands apart in any kind of yard style and helps to make the space really feel even more welcoming, specifically at night hours as the sun begins to set. Do it yourself firepits are very easy to discover and install, or you can buy a stand-alone fire bowl that does not need anything extra, besides a risk-free place to rest. “You can get a firepit for a few hundred bucks, or you could buy an elegant, contemporary alternative for around $10,000,” Turner states. Eventually, it depends upon your individual preferences and spending plan.

5. Basic Illumination Accents
Including illumination accents to a yard allows for more use of the area throughout the day, night, and night. House owners can set up solar garden lights that don’t call for electrical wiring, making it very easy to light up the yard, light strolling courses, or make decks and patios more inviting. You can also mount wired lights for the yard; while it will certainly set you back a little bit much more and involve even more effort to mount, this can be a lasting and trusted lighting option. “Low voltage LED lights will be around $200, and they’ll develop a large change in your outside room,” Turner claims.

6. Seating Location Addition
Sitting or laying on a grass can be a great method to enjoy your outdoor space, however, for those who favor to being in a chair or unwind on a patio area, there are lots of means to include seating options to a yard. “Seats areas made with gravel or disintegrated granite will be much more budget-friendly than concrete or rock and run around $500 to $1,500,” Turner claims.

Several DIYers can set up patio areas or decks by themselves, removing the expense of labor. “This will typically be around $3,000 to 10,000. This significantly depends on size and product however,” keeps in mind Turner. Similarly, pergolas and color frameworks can improve the comfort and comfort of the yard, though Turner additionally states these will certainly average around $5,000, depending upon the size.
Tips to Minimize Yard Renovation Costs
One of the very best methods to lower the expense of backyard improvements is to acquire materials or perform components of the job in the off-season when vendors and contractors might be a lot more ready to provide discounts. You need to additionally consider aligning your improvement task with tax return season to ensure that you can invest a return into your home, as opposed to drawing from your daily spending plan. Ultimately, consider which jobs add value to your home to raise its interest possible buyers.

Turner uses some additional suggestions to aid handle your project and minimize renovation expenses:

Break jobs into stages to spread out prices with time.
Use pea gravel instead of flagstone, or pressure-treated wood over composite decking.
Do it yourself tasks like growing, painting, and simple stonework can decrease labor costs dramatically.
Big orders of pavers, compost, or gravel frequently come with discount rates.
